Hi Dmitry,
You pointed out a good point.  I passed the literal "--socket-mem=2048,2048" in 
the array provided to rte_eal_init() function, where DPDK EAL tries to tokenize 
in place the string and it crashes trying to modify a readonly memory.  I don't 
know why DPDK does this.  But now I know, and I now see four rtemap_x files 
created for two sockets.
